Summer has a way of reminding us to slow down and actually experience our lives. Before the season slips away, give yourself permission to savor it. Feel the warmth of the sun on your skin. Listen to the sound of laughter, birds, or music drifting through an open window. Notice the sweetness of a perfectly ripe peach, the scent of sunscreen and fresh-cut grass, the glow of the evening sky. Don’t rush past these moments, immerse yourself in them. When you engage your senses, you become more present, more playful, and more alive. And that, my friend, is where your flirt begins.
Flirting isn’t just something you do with another person. It’s a way of engaging with life through curiosity, pleasure, presence, and play. When you slow down enough to notice what feels good, you naturally begin to open your energy. You become more aware of your surroundings, your body, your emotions, and the people around you. That awareness creates the kind of magnetic presence that no pickup line can manufacture. So, before summer ends, flirt with your senses. Take the long way home. Dip your toes in the water. Wear something that makes you feel beautiful. Taste something delicious. Look up at the sky. Smile at a stranger. Let yourself be delighted. Because flirting is ultimately about reclaiming your aliveness and there is no better time to practice than right now.
